Subject: ChipTrail handover

Omar,

Handing over the ChipTrail reader DBs before I'm out. Splits land in the results cluster; readers flush every 5s. Backups nightly, retention 30 days. New folks should know: never restart a reader mid-race. Primary results database is reachable via the connection string below.

— Lise

primary connection of yagep-kahip = redis://giliel_svc:zYiKsLL2PLpfPL@db-348f.xolmarsys.corp:5432/fenwyn

Action item from the Ordwell outage: hard deletes on the orders table destroyed audit history during the cleanup job. Reviewer: confirm all delete paths now set deleted_at instead of issuing DELETE, and that the reaper job only purges rows past the retention window. Reject any migration that drops the soft-delete column. The reaper runs hourly; batch sizes were cut after the incident to keep replication lag under control. Verify the new constants match what staging was soak-tested with. Current values:

constants for tageg-kagag:
QUOTAS = {
    "kelax": 495,
    "istath": 366,
    "tammir": 108,
    "novdor": 730,
    "casax": 816,
    "quenael": 874,
    "pelius": 403,
}

Subject: Revised Sales-Commission Scheme

Heads of department,

Effective next quarter, Verrowdale Partners moves to a tiered commission scheme. Base rates drop two points, but accelerators above 110% of quota rise sharply. Multi-year contracts on the Skelfort platform earn a further uplift. Existing pipeline closes under current terms until the cutover date. Detailed tables go to team leads Friday; please hold announcements until then. The strategic reasoning behind this change is stated below.

board note of bawep-tajef: Queniusek Systems plans to raise the Quenvan list price by 53.1 percent in March. The pricing group signed off on a budget of $176.4 million for Project Drueth. The renewal with Casionix Partners closes at $142.5 million a year, 8.3 percent below the last contract. Project Fraax slips by six weeks because of the tooling delay.

Ticket: Flagpole rollout framework — expired credential

The Flagpole feature-flag rollout framework lost access to the Gatekeep evaluation service at 03:10; the service account credential passed its expiry and all flag evaluations fell back to defaults. No sensitive data was exposed. A replacement key has been issued with the same read-only scope. For the security review record, the new credential is below.

API key for yahig-tadup: kto7_ubizbYm